Simulated seismic tests on 1/42- and 1/14-scale category 1, auxiliary building

Description

Two scale-model structures representing an idealized auxiliary building were seismically tested. The scales (1/42, 1/14) were chosen so that both structures were models of the prototype, and the 1/42-scale model was a 1/3-scale model of the 1/14-scale structure. Both models were constructed out of microconcrete. The 1/42-scale used wire mesh to simulate reinforcing, and the 1/14-scale used model deformed bars. The general result verified previous test experience in this program: the frequency response of these structures, when subjected to seismic design loads, will be below that predicted for the structure using conventional analysis methods. This implies the frequency content and magnitude of floor response spectra, in general, will not be as predicted from the structural analysis. The implication of this result for equipment and piping is under investigation. The recommendation of this program, based on testing thus far, is to verify the conclusions on larger real concrete structures of a geometry that will be agreed upon by the technical review group for this program. 5 refs., 17 figs., 7 tabs
